Real-World Studies Confirm RSV Immunizations Protect Infants from Hospitalization
Real-world studies show nirsevimab reduced RSV infant hospitalizations by up to 72% and maternal vaccination cut hospitalizations by nearly 70%, with benefits extending into the second RSV season.
New real-world studies confirm that recently developed immunizations against respiratory syncytial virus (RSV) protect infants in their first year of life. The research, including studies in France, the United Kingdom, the United States, and Spain, shows that both maternal vaccination and the infant monoclonal antibody nirsevimab substantially reduce RSV-related hospitalizations.
In a nationwide French study of nearly 75,000 infants published in JAMA Pediatrics, newborns immunized with nirsevimab (sold in the United States as Beyfortus) during the 2023–2024 respiratory season were 66% less likely to be hospitalized with RSV. Those immunized during the 2024–25 season were 72% less likely. Nirsevimab provides lab-grown antibodies that protect babies immediately, but the protection lasts only about five months, covering the first respiratory season. The researchers also found a small increase in the risk of hospitalization for ear, nose, and throat infections among immunized infants, but they cautioned the finding was based on a small number of cases and does not outweigh the benefits of RSV immunization.
Two new studies evaluated maternal RSV vaccination. A British study published online in The Lancet Child & Adolescent Health found that babies whose mothers were vaccinated during weeks 28 to 31 of pregnancy were 61% less likely to be hospitalized for RSV in their first six months of life. Newborns under 3 months of age were 76% less likely. A separate U.S. study led by researchers at the University of Pittsburgh and UPMC, published in JAMA Network Open, found that one dose of the maternal RSVpreF vaccine reduced RSV-related hospitalization in young infants by nearly 70%. Among infants younger than 3 months, effectiveness was approximately 68% against RSV-related hospitalization and 69% against severe lung infections caused by the virus. The U.S. study analyzed health records from infants 90 days old or younger hospitalized during the 2023–2024 and 2024–2025 RSV seasons in Western Pennsylvania. The maternal RSV vaccine is recommended between 32 and 36 weeks of pregnancy and typically given between September and January in most of the United States, according to the CDC.
A universal RSV immunization programme with nirsevimab also showed benefits beyond the first RSV season. The NIRSE-GAL study in Galicia, Spain, published in The Lancet Infectious Diseases and presented at the RSVVW '26 conference in Rome, found 55.3% fewer hospitalizations in the second RSV season among infants who had received a dose of nirsevimab during their first season. It is the first prospective real-world population study to evaluate the impact of a universal nirsevimab programme across two consecutive RSV seasons.
RSV remains a major threat to infants: it hospitalizes 1.4 million babies around the world every year, making it the most common cause of hospital admission for respiratory disease in infants, and it kills nearly 46,000 babies under 6 months of age annually, according to the World Health Organization.
